Amazon.com description: Product Description:
An artist unbound by the conventions of his time, Munich-based painter Peter Schermuly (1997â2007) turned away from abstraction toward an original approach to realism in which he developed color phenomena suitable for a particular painting rather than merely recreating the palette he observed in the world around him.
          Â
Peter Schermuly: Catalogue Raisonné brings together a wealth of full-color illustrations to present an overview of the artistâs entire painterly oeuvre. The book includes Schermulyâs well-known oil paintings but also his sketches and wall designs. Together, the works form a long-awaited introduction to the life and work of this important and original figure in twentieth-century art.
